Table 1.
Chemical physical characterization of nanoparticles and nanoconjugates used in this work
Sample | DLS (nm) | std (nm) | Zeta potential (mV) | std (mV) | Loading (n. VIVIT/NP) |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
MYTS | 22.9 | 1.4 | −49.8 | 1.5 | – |
MYTS-VIVIT | 22.6 | 2.4 | −45.1 | 1.5 | 17.0 |
MYTS-PEG | 26.2 | 1.6 | −49.1 | 1.8 | – |
PMDA | 5.4 | 0.2 | −40.1 | 4.5 | – |
PMDA-VIVIT | 5.5 | 0.2 | −29.5 | 4.2 | 0.6–1.6a |
PMDA-PEG | 5.5 | 0.6 | −30.9 | 3.9 | – |
HFn | 13.0 | 3.1 | −11.6 | 5.6 | – |
HFn(VIVIT) | 13.4 | 3.0 | −10.2 | 4.4 | 38.4 |
All measurements were conducted in 10 mM ionic strength, pH 7.35.
The value is size-dependent (in the range 5–9 nm) calculated at a density of 1 mg/mL.
